Who is The scientist Richard D. Wood?
Human molecular biology focuses on DNA repair and mutation. He is also known for his pioneering studies on nucleotide excision correction and which he used to conduct research at the Imperial Cancer Research Foundation.
He is a jazz bassist who plays in local bands with his wife.
 
 

Young / Before famous

He attended Westminster College before receiving his doctorate degree in Biological Physics from the University of California, Berkeley in 1977.
